Emotions are a fundamental part of the human experience, shaping our perceptions, decisions, and actions. While they can serve as valuable guides to help us navigate the world, they can also be a source of turmoil and dissatisfaction. Mastering our emotions is essential for lasting contentment, allowing us to cultivate a sense of inner peace, resilience, and fulfillment. In this article, we will explore how to understand, manage, and transform emotions to create a life that is rooted in lasting happiness and contentment.
At their core, emotions are physiological responses to stimuli, whether internal or external. They are a natural part of our evolutionary makeup, designed to alert us to potential threats, opportunities, or needs. Emotions can be categorized into primary emotions, such as joy, anger, sadness, fear, surprise, and disgust, and secondary emotions, which are more complex and often result from a combination of primary emotions (e.g., shame, guilt, pride).
Emotions are not inherently good or bad; they are signals that inform us about our environment, relationships, and internal states. However, how we interpret and respond to emotions determines their impact on our well-being. If we lack awareness of our emotions or allow them to control us, they can lead to stress, anxiety, and dissatisfaction.
Contentment is a state of being at peace with oneself and one's circumstances, characterized by a sense of fulfillment, gratitude, and acceptance. Unlike fleeting happiness, which is often dependent on external circumstances, contentment is a deeper, more stable emotion that arises from within.
To achieve lasting contentment, it is crucial to master our emotional responses. When we are able to navigate our emotions with awareness and control, we can cultivate an inner sense of peace and fulfillment, regardless of external circumstances. Emotions such as anger, frustration, or fear, when unmanaged, can create emotional turbulence that prevents us from experiencing true contentment. However, by learning to understand and manage these emotions, we can create a foundation of emotional stability that supports lasting happiness.
The first step in mastering your emotions is to develop emotional awareness. Emotional awareness involves recognizing and understanding the emotions you are experiencing in any given moment. This requires mindfulness---the ability to observe your thoughts, feelings, and bodily sensations without judgment. When you are aware of your emotions, you can choose how to respond to them, rather than reacting impulsively.
By practicing emotional awareness, you create space between stimulus and response, allowing you to choose a thoughtful, intentional reaction rather than being driven by automatic emotional responses.
Emotional regulation is the ability to manage and control your emotions, particularly in challenging or stressful situations. It involves understanding how to calm yourself when overwhelmed by negative emotions, as well as how to amplify positive emotions such as joy and gratitude.
By practicing emotional regulation, you gain greater control over how you respond to life's challenges, allowing you to maintain your composure and sense of contentment, even in difficult situations.
Emotional intelligence (EQ) is the ability to perceive, understand, manage, and influence emotions---both your own and those of others. Developing EQ allows you to navigate relationships more effectively, resolve conflicts, and create a harmonious social environment, all of which contribute to lasting contentment.
By developing emotional intelligence, you can respond to others with greater understanding and empathy, creating more fulfilling and meaningful relationships. Healthy relationships, in turn, contribute to a greater sense of happiness and contentment.
While it is important to manage negative emotions, it is equally important to actively cultivate positive emotions. Positive emotions such as joy, gratitude, love, and compassion can enhance your well-being and create a sense of lasting contentment. By intentionally focusing on positive emotions, you can shift your mindset and increase your overall sense of happiness.
By cultivating positive emotions, you create a reservoir of emotional strength that can help you weather life's challenges with resilience and grace.
One of the keys to mastering your emotions and achieving contentment is learning to let go of unnecessary attachments. Many of our emotional struggles arise from clinging to external circumstances, people, or outcomes. When we tie our happiness to things outside of our control, we set ourselves up for disappointment and frustration.
Letting go of unnecessary attachments allows you to live more freely and authentically, unburdened by external pressures and emotional baggage.
Mastering your emotions is not a one-time achievement but a continuous process of growth and self-awareness. It requires a commitment to self-care and well-being, as your emotional health is deeply interconnected with your physical and mental health.
Your physical health plays a crucial role in how you experience and manage emotions. Poor nutrition, lack of exercise, and insufficient sleep can exacerbate emotional volatility and make it harder to regulate your feelings. By taking care of your body through regular exercise, balanced nutrition, and adequate rest, you create a strong foundation for emotional well-being.
Mental health practices such as therapy, counseling, or stress management techniques can also be beneficial in mastering your emotions. Therapy can help you uncover underlying beliefs or unresolved issues that may be influencing your emotional responses. Additionally, practicing relaxation techniques like yoga or progressive muscle relaxation can help reduce stress and enhance emotional regulation.
Surrounding yourself with a supportive network of friends, family, or community members is essential for maintaining emotional well-being. Positive social connections provide emotional support, encouragement, and a sense of belonging, all of which contribute to lasting contentment.
Mastering your emotions is a powerful tool for achieving lasting contentment. By developing emotional awareness, practicing regulation, embracing emotional intelligence, cultivating positive emotions, and letting go of unnecessary attachments, you can create a foundation of inner peace and resilience. With commitment and practice, you can navigate the complexities of life with greater ease and experience a sense of fulfillment that transcends external circumstances. Emotional mastery is not about suppressing or denying emotions, but about learning to respond to them in a way that fosters growth, well-being, and lasting happiness.
